Optical display system having a Brewster's angle regulating film

1. A display system comprising:

  • a displaying device for generating a display light of information;

    a light-polarizing device for polarizing the display light;

    at least one transparent plate having a refractive index and a corresponding Brewster'"'"'s angle when interfaced with air;

    a Brewster'"'"'s angle regulating film secured to a surface of said transparent plate, said Brewster'"'"'s angle regulating film having a refractive index different from that of said transparent plate and having a Brewster'"'"'s angle in air, said Brewster'"'"'s angle regulating film being itself transparent whereby substantially all display light incident thereon passes through said Brewster'"'"'s angle regulating film, preventing said display light from being reflected by said Brewster'"'"'s angle regulating film;

    wherein the polarized display light is incident on said Brewster'"'"'s angle regulating film at an angle around Brewster'"'"'s angle of said Brewster'"'"'s angle regulating film, travels through said Brewster'"'"'s angle regulating film to said transparent plate and is reflected toward a side of said displaying device;

    wherein said displaying device is locatable to provide display light to said transparent plate at an angle exceeding Brewster'"'"'s angle of said transparent plate corresponding to an interface with air.
